Plagiarism
Plagiarism is the act of copying out all or part of someone else’s work and pretending it is your own – that is to say, using someone else’s words without the appropriate attribution of ownership. We will NOT tolerate plagiarism – from published work of any sort or from other students’ work – in this assignment. The reasons why you CANNOT AND MUST NOT plagiarize are as follows:

– it is against University of Essex regulations (go to http://www2.essex.ac.uk/academic/calendar/examregs.html#Examination%20Regulations and scroll down to 6.12 for full details);
– it is tantamount to cheating – there is no creative or intellectual effort involved in copying out someone else’s work;
– you fail to prove to us that you understand what you are talking about if you copy out what someone else has said, because you are using their words and not yours;
– authors do not write books or articles so that students can copy chunks out of them and still succeed in fulfilling the demands of their assessed work – so, if you plagiarize, it is unlikely that your assignment will conform to the assignment guidelines that we have set out above.

Therefore, unless you are directly quoting (and you need to reference a direct quotation properly, for which full guidance is given in the referencing guidelines that follow), make sure that you write in YOUR OWN WORDS – which does NOT mean copying out other people’s material and changing words here and there. You should also be aware that downloading sections or phrases from material on the Internet and reproducing them in your assignment, unless they are referenced correctly, also counts as plagiarism.

In “The Great Non-Debate over Sweatshop Labor” Maitland claims that the main arguments against sweatshop labor are not convincing, and that sweatshop conditions are, in fact, morally justified. His arguments are largely utilitarian—he focuses on the consequences of improving working conditions, argues that they are undesirable, and concludes that the current wages and working conditions are morally justified. “No net loss” policy in regards to wetlands

In the late 1980s, the United States established a “no net loss” policy in regards to wetlands. Simply stated, this policy called for the construction or restoration of artificial wetlands whenever an action would lead to the destruction of an existing wetland. This would ensure that the overall area of wetlands in the United States would remain constant. While a noble goal, many researchers have argued that both artificial and restored wetlands are not biologically equal in quality with their natural counterparts. The advantages of budgeting

It is a group eassy which is to discuss whether budgeting should be abolished,my job is to write three advantages of budgeting.

Please focus on the following points and expand them to around 400 words

1.Planning orientation. The process of creating a budget takes management away from its short-term, day-to-day management of the business and forces it to think longer-term.

2.Cash allocation. There is only a limited amount of cash available to invest in fixed assets and working capital, and the budgeting process forces management to decide which assets are most worth investing in.

3.Bottleneck analysis. Nearly every company has a bottleneck somewhere, and the budgeting process can be used to concentrate on what can be done to either expand the capacity of that bottleneck or to shift work around it.
